Official abstract text for this publication.
A system and method are provided for conducting a primary lottery game in conjunction with a televised game show and a play-at-home version of the show. In the primary lottery game, players purchase lottery tickets, with each ticket having a unique web code. Players of the primary lottery game become eligible to be a contestant in the show by accumulating a predefined set of game symbols in the lottery game. During broadcast of the game show, a plurality of game symbol codes are provided to at-home viewers of the show who are also players of the primary lottery game. The at-home viewers are able to access a website, enter the web code from their lottery ticket, enter one the game symbol codes broadcast with the game show, and play a web-based game to win a game symbol associated with the entered game symbol code.

What is claimed is: 1. A method for conducting a lottery game in conjunction with a televised game show and a play-at-home version of the televised game show, comprising: establishing a primary lottery game in one or more lottery jurisdictions wherein players purchase lottery tickets to play the primary lottery game; establishing a televised game show wherein the players of the primary lottery game become eligible to be selected as a contestant in the televised game show by accumulating a predefined set of game symbols, the televised game show having one or more games wherein winning contestants are awarded a prize, and the televised game show including one or more future episodes; providing a web code on the lottery tickets, the web code unique to each of the lottery tickets; during broadcast of the televised game show in the one or more lottery jurisdictions, providing the players who are also at-home viewers of the televised game show with a plurality of game symbol codes; enabling the players to access a website, enter the web code from a lottery ticket purchased by the respective player, enter one of the game symbol codes broadcast during the televised game show, and play a web-based game to win a game symbol associated with the entered game symbol code, the game symbol being one of the predefined set of game symbols and being accumulated by the respective player towards the predefined set of game symbols; configuring each of the lottery tickets in the primary lottery game with a respective one of the predefined set of game symbols printed thereon, wherein the players also accumulate game symbols toward the predefined set of game symbols by purchase of the lottery tickets in the primary lottery game, wherein the game symbols accumulated by the players via play of the web-based game and play of the primary lottery game are combined to satisfy the predefined set of game symbols to become eligible as a contestant in the televised game show; and providing the players with a game board that is specifically configured for use in tracking status of the game symbols accumulated by the player from play of the web-based game and purchase of the lottery tickets in the primary lottery game; wherein upon acquiring all of the game symbols in the predefined set of game symbols, the player advances towards being selected as a contestant in one of the future episodes of the televised game show. 2. The method as in claim 1 , wherein the game symbols are for play of a bonus game component of the primary lottery game that requires the player to collect the predefined set of game symbols for entry into a pool, and periodically conducting bonus game drawings such that at least one of the players in the pool is selected as a winner in each bonus game drawing. 3. The method as in claim 2 , wherein the winners in the bonus game drawings are invited to be an audience member in one of the future episodes of the televised game show and eligible for selection as a contestant in the future televised game show. 4. The method as in claim 2 , wherein each lottery jurisdiction conducts respective bonus game drawings and has a defined minimum number of winners from their respective bonus game drawings present in an audience in the future episode of the televised game show, wherein contestants in the future episode of the televised game show are then randomly drawn from an entirety of the audience. 5. The method as in claim 2 , wherein each lottery jurisdiction conducts respective bonus game drawings and has a defined minimum number of winners from their respective bonus game drawings present in an audience in the future episode of the televised game show, wherein at least one contestant in the future episode of the televised game show is then randomly drawn from each lottery jurisdiction such that each lottery jurisdiction has at least one contestant in the future episode of the televised game show. 6. The method as in claim 1 , wherein upon satisfaction of the predefined set of game symbols, the players are awarded a defined number of entries in a bonus game drawing. 7. The method as in claim 6 , wherein the defined number of entries is multiplied as a function of a multiplier symbol earned by participation of the player in a second primary lottery game that is played separately from the primary lottery game. 8. The method as in claim 1 , wherein the game board has a MONOPOLY game theme, the game symbols identify sets of property locations on the MONOPOLY game board. 9. The method as in claim 8 , wherein the game board is a virtual game board provided to the players via the website or a different website accessible by the players. 10. The method as in claim 9 , further comprising establishing individual player accounts that are accessible by the players via the website, the player accounts including the virtual game board updated with a status of the game symbols accumulated by the player. 11. The method as in claim 1 , wherein the game symbols associated with the game symbol codes are made known to the player prior to selection and entry of a particular game symbol code by the player during at-home viewing of the televised game show. 12. The method as in claim 1 , wherein the game symbol codes limit at-home play of the web-based game to a time corresponding to broadcast of the televised game show within the lottery jurisdiction where the player is located. 13. The method as in claim 1 , wherein the game symbol codes are episode specific and valid only once and only during a broadcast time of the televised game show in which the game symbol codes are provided. 14. The method as in claim 13 , wherein the game symbol codes are also geographic specific and valid only in a specific geographic region of a particular one of the lottery jurisdictions. 15. The method as in claim 1 , wherein the primary lottery game is established in a plurality of the lottery jurisdictions, each of the tottery jurisdictions being geographically distinct and the televised game show is broadcast in each of the lottery jurisdictions, wherein a unique set of the game symbol codes is assigned to each of the lottery jurisdictions such that the at-home viewer must use the unique game symbol codes assigned to their respective lottery jurisdiction to play the web-based game.
